Question:

Can steel profiles be used in renewable energy projects?

Answer:

Yes, steel profiles can be used in renewable energy projects. Steel profiles offer numerous benefits such as high strength, durability, and versatility, making them suitable for various applications in renewable energy projects. They can be used in the construction of wind turbine towers, solar panel mounting structures, and supports for hydropower systems. Additionally, steel profiles have a high recyclability rate, aligning with the sustainability goals of renewable energy projects.
